How We Litigate

At the outset we take special care to learn all of the relevant facts known by the client. We fully analyze the controversy, prepare our theory of the case, and promptly decide upon the best course of action. We then set out to compile the necessary proofs and defeat the various counter measures that we anticipate our adversary will employ.

Next, we attempt to resolve the client's matter through negotiations or mediation. Our philosophy is that all avenues of negotiation should be exhausted prior to entering into protracted litigation. If negotiations cannot resolve the issue, we are then in a position to use the information obtained during negotiations to initiate full litigation to resolve the client's claim.

We take the initiative, rather than merely respond to what the adversary does, every stage and particularly at trial to state our client's best possible case in light of the evidence and prevailing laws.
